A collection of 18 Atari arcade games and 81 Atari 2600 games for a total of 99 Atari games for $15 for the iPhone, iPod Touch and iPad. It's also optimized for iPad so it's not just pixel doubled.

Tempest is perfect on the Phone, the arcade version anyway. They give you a dial on the left side (slide up and down) so you have the same type of control as you do with the arcade game's rotary dial. It is blissful.
